About Single Point Capital
Learn more about Single Point Capital, a client-focused freight factoring company in Humble, Texas that provides provides a complete suite of financial services, logistics, and back office support to our customers and partners.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Houston?

Understanding the cost of living near Houston is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Single Point Capital.
Houston's Cost of Living Index is approximately 98.5 (1.5% less expensive than US average; 5.9% more than TX average). Major city, energy/medical hub, housing generally affordable for size, but varies. METRO bus/rail.
